| Summary | 087: Gitweb Parsing Fails when Human Reable Path Feature is Enabled | ||||||||||
| Description | In gitweb, it is possible to change the file paths to more human readable form. This is done by setting the 'pathinfo' option in the gitweb.conf file like so: $feature{'pathinfo'}{'default'} = [1]; If you enable this feature, it will break the source code integration. This is caused because the gitweb plugin relies on the default style of URL tags to extract commit information. | ||||||||||
